How To Calculate For Variance

Variance Calculator

Calculate the variance of a dataset with step-by-step results and visual representation. Enter your data points below to compute both population and sample variance.

Please enter valid numbers separated by commas

Variance Calculation Results

Number of Data Points (n):
Mean (μ):
Sum of Squares:
Variance Type:
Variance (σ² or s²):
Standard Deviation (σ or s):

Comprehensive Guide: How to Calculate Variance

Variance is a fundamental statistical measure that quantifies the spread between numbers in a data set. Understanding how to calculate variance is essential for data analysis, quality control, financial modeling, and scientific research. This comprehensive guide will walk you through the concepts, formulas, and practical applications of variance calculation.

What is Variance?

Variance measures how far each number in a data set is from the mean (average) of the set. A high variance indicates that the data points are very spread out from the mean, while a low variance suggests they are clustered close to the mean.

Key characteristics of variance:

  • Always non-negative (variance cannot be less than zero)
  • Measured in squared units (if original data is in meters, variance is in square meters)
  • Sensitive to outliers (extreme values can significantly increase variance)
  • Used as the basis for calculating standard deviation

Population Variance vs. Sample Variance

There are two main types of variance calculations, depending on whether you’re working with an entire population or a sample:

Characteristic Population Variance (σ²) Sample Variance (s²)
Data Scope All members of the population Subset of the population
Formula Denominator N (number of data points) n-1 (degrees of freedom)
Notation σ² (sigma squared)
Use Case When you have complete data When estimating population variance
Bias Unbiased Unbiased estimator

The Variance Formula

The general approach to calculating variance follows these steps:

  1. Calculate the mean (average) of the data set
  2. For each data point, subtract the mean and square the result (the squared difference)
  3. Sum all the squared differences
  4. Divide by the number of data points (for population) or n-1 (for sample)

Population Variance Formula:

σ² = (Σ(xi – μ)²) / N

Where:

  • σ² = population variance
  • Σ = summation symbol
  • xi = each individual data point
  • μ = population mean
  • N = number of data points in population

Sample Variance Formula:

s² = (Σ(xi – x̄)²) / (n – 1)

Where:

  • s² = sample variance
  • x̄ = sample mean
  • n = number of data points in sample
  • n-1 = degrees of freedom

Step-by-Step Calculation Example

Let’s calculate both population and sample variance for this data set: 5, 7, 8, 8, 10, 12

Step 1: Calculate the Mean

Mean = (5 + 7 + 8 + 8 + 10 + 12) / 6 = 50 / 6 ≈ 8.33

Step 2: Calculate Squared Differences from Mean

Data Point (xi) Difference (xi – μ) Squared Difference (xi – μ)²
5 5 – 8.33 = -3.33 11.09
7 7 – 8.33 = -1.33 1.77
8 8 – 8.33 = -0.33 0.11
8 8 – 8.33 = -0.33 0.11
10 10 – 8.33 = 1.67 2.79
12 12 – 8.33 = 3.67 13.47
Sum 29.34

Step 3: Calculate Population Variance

σ² = 29.34 / 6 ≈ 4.89

Step 4: Calculate Sample Variance

s² = 29.34 / (6-1) = 29.34 / 5 ≈ 5.87

Why Use n-1 for Sample Variance?

The use of n-1 (instead of n) in the sample variance formula is known as Bessel’s correction. This adjustment makes the sample variance an unbiased estimator of the population variance. Without this correction, sample variance would systematically underestimate the population variance.

Mathematically, the expected value of the sample variance (with n-1) equals the population variance:

E[s²] = σ²

This property doesn’t hold if we divide by n instead of n-1. The correction becomes particularly important with small sample sizes.

Practical Applications of Variance

Variance has numerous real-world applications across various fields:

  • Finance: Used in portfolio theory to measure risk (volatility of asset returns)
  • Quality Control: Monitoring manufacturing processes for consistency
  • Machine Learning: Feature selection and dimensionality reduction
  • Psychology: Analyzing test score distributions
  • Meteorology: Studying temperature variations
  • Sports Analytics: Evaluating player performance consistency
  • Biology: Measuring genetic diversity in populations

Variance vs. Standard Deviation

While variance measures the squared deviation from the mean, standard deviation is simply the square root of variance. Both measure dispersion, but they have different applications:

Characteristic Variance Standard Deviation
Units Squared units (e.g., m²) Original units (e.g., m)
Interpretability Less intuitive More intuitive (same units as data)
Mathematical Properties Additive for independent variables Not additive
Use in Formulas Common in theoretical statistics Common in applied statistics
Sensitivity to Outliers More sensitive (squaring amplifies outliers) Less sensitive than variance

In practice, standard deviation is often preferred for reporting because it’s in the same units as the original data, making it more interpretable. However, variance is essential in many statistical formulas and theories.

Common Mistakes in Variance Calculation

Avoid these frequent errors when calculating variance:

  1. Confusing population and sample variance: Using the wrong formula can lead to systematically biased results. Always consider whether your data represents a complete population or just a sample.
  2. Incorrect mean calculation: The mean must be calculated precisely, as all subsequent calculations depend on it. Rounding errors in the mean can compound in variance calculations.
  3. Forgetting to square differences: Variance requires squared differences from the mean. Forgetting to square will give you the mean absolute deviation instead.
  4. Division errors: Using n instead of n-1 for sample variance (or vice versa) will give incorrect results. Remember Bessel’s correction for samples.
  5. Data entry errors: Typos in data points can dramatically affect variance, especially with small data sets. Always double-check your data.
  6. Ignoring units: Variance is in squared units of the original data. Forgetting this can lead to misinterpretation of results.
  7. Assuming normal distribution: While variance is defined for any distribution, some interpretations assume normality. Always check distribution shape for proper interpretation.

Advanced Topics in Variance

For those looking to deepen their understanding, here are some advanced concepts related to variance:

Pooled Variance

When comparing two samples, pooled variance combines the variances of both samples, weighted by their degrees of freedom. It’s used in t-tests and ANOVA:

sₚ² = [(n₁ – 1)s₁² + (n₂ – 1)s₂²] / (n₁ + n₂ – 2)

Variance of a Sum

For independent random variables, the variance of their sum equals the sum of their variances:

Var(X + Y) = Var(X) + Var(Y)

Variance Inflation Factor (VIF)

In regression analysis, VIF measures how much the variance of an estimated regression coefficient increases due to collinearity with other predictors. VIF > 5 or 10 indicates problematic multicollinearity.

Analysis of Variance (ANOVA)

ANOVA partitions the total variance in a dataset into components attributable to different sources. It’s fundamental for comparing means across multiple groups.

Variance in Probability Distributions

Different probability distributions have different variance formulas:

  • Binomial Distribution: Var(X) = nπ(1-π)
  • Poisson Distribution: Var(X) = λ (mean)
  • Normal Distribution: Variance is σ² (the distribution is defined by its mean and variance)
  • Uniform Distribution: Var(X) = (b-a)²/12 for interval [a,b]
  • Exponential Distribution: Var(X) = 1/λ²

Calculating Variance in Software

Most statistical software and programming languages have built-in functions for calculating variance:

  • Excel: =VAR.P() for population variance, =VAR.S() for sample variance
  • Python (NumPy): np.var() with ddof parameter (ddof=0 for population, ddof=1 for sample)
  • R: var() (defaults to sample variance with n-1)
  • SQL: VAR_POP() and VAR_SAMP() functions
  • Google Sheets: =VARP() and =VAR()

When using software, always verify whether the function calculates population or sample variance by default.

Learning Resources

For further study on variance and related statistical concepts, consider these authoritative resources:

Conclusion

Understanding how to calculate variance is a cornerstone of statistical analysis. Whether you’re working with population data or samples, the variance provides crucial insights into the spread and consistency of your data. By mastering both the mathematical foundations and practical applications of variance, you’ll be better equipped to:

  • Assess the reliability of your data
  • Compare the consistency of different datasets
  • Make informed decisions based on data variability
  • Apply advanced statistical techniques that rely on variance
  • Communicate data characteristics effectively to stakeholders

Remember that variance is just one measure of dispersion. For a complete picture of your data’s distribution, consider using it alongside other statistics like standard deviation, range, and interquartile range. The calculator provided at the top of this page gives you a practical tool to compute variance quickly while understanding each step of the calculation process.

Leave a Reply

Your email address will not be published. Required fields are marked *